Getting in the festive spirit with ArgylePrimaryKingsCross in Urban Forest School sessions. Talked about evergreen and deciduous trees and how plants like holly and ivy traditionally celebrate this time of year. Children then built fine motor skills as they learnt to weave ivy crowns.


Yr 3 ArgylePrimaryKingsCross completed their 6 week Seed to Supper project. Pupils learnt to pull up weeds from the root, plant bulbs and vegetable seeds.🧅 They can harvest food, chop vegetables, light fires and make butter. They have cared for their garden, its wildlife and themselves
